package jakarta.faces.component;

import jakarta.el.MethodExpression;

/**
 * 

* ActionSource2 extends {@link ActionSource} and provides a JavaBeans * "action" property. The type of this property is a {@link MethodExpression}. * This allows the ActionSource concept to leverage the Jakarta Expression Language API. *

* * @since 1.2 * @deprecated Use {@link ActionSource} instead. */ @Deprecated(since = "4.1", forRemoval = true) public interface ActionSource2 extends ActionSource { // -------------------------------------------------------------- Properties /** *

* Return the {@link MethodExpression} pointing at the application action to be invoked, if this {@link UIComponent} is * activated by the user, during the Apply Request Values or Invoke Application phase of the request * processing lifecycle, depending on the value of the immediate property. *

* * @return the action expression. */ MethodExpression getActionExpression(); /** *

* Set the {@link MethodExpression} pointing at the appication action to be invoked, if this {@link UIComponent} is * activated by the user, during the Apply Request Values or Invoke Application phase of the request * processing lifecycle, depending on the value of the immediate property. *

* *

* Any method referenced by such an expression must be public, with a return type of String, and accept no * parameters. *

* * @param action The new method expression */ void setActionExpression(MethodExpression action); }
